A Heck of a Root with a Rich Legacy

Beets are more than just a colorful root crop—they are a living testament to how ancient wisdom and modern science can come together in the garden. Across centuries, cultures around the globe have prized beets for their vibrant color, culinary versatility, and healing power.

Today, beets are enjoying a well-deserved revival, not only for their nutritional profile but also for their impressive role in detoxification and cancer prevention. For gardeners, planting beets offers a double reward: a hardy crop that grows well in most climates and a deeply nourishing food that supports whole-body wellness.

The Science Behind the Color: Betalains and Their Powerful Detox Power

Beets owe their deep crimson hue to betalains, powerful phytonutrients with ant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ties. These compounds do more than please the eye—they help neutralize damaging free radicals and reduce chronic inflammation, both of which are key contributors to cancer development.

Emerging research suggests that betalains may protect DNA, support cellular repair, and inhibit tumor-promoting pathways. Alongside these pigments, beets contain betaine, a liver-supportive compound that enhances detoxification and helps flush toxins before they can do harm. With each bite, beets contribute to a biological cleanup that starts in the liver and radiates outward.

The Hidden Benefit of Beet Fiber and Gut Health

Beets are also high in dietary fiber, which helps maintain digestive regularity and fosters a thriving gut microbiome. A healthy gut is crucial for immune resilience and cancer prevention.

Beneficial microbes help break down toxins, reduce inflammation, and even regulate hormone levels—all important in reducing cancer risk. Whether raw, roasted, or fermented, beets deliver a synergy of nutrients that nourish your body from the inside out.

How to Grow Beets for Maximum Nutrition

Growing beets in your own garden isn’t just easy—it’s deeply rewarding. These roots thrive in loose, well-drained soil enriched with compost.

They prefer cool-season planting and tolerate partial shade, making them ideal for spring or fall gardens. Raised beds or deep containers work well if space is limited. Just keep the soil consistently moist, thin seedlings properly, and avoid over-fertilizing with nitrogen, which can result in leafy tops but stunted roots.

Balanced organic fertilizers and occasional foliar feeding with compost tea or seaweed extract can supercharge beet growth and nutrient density.

The Art of Companion Planting for Beets

Pairing beets with the right neighbors can reduce pests and promote healthier plants. Onions, garlic, and cabbage family crops deter beet-loving insects, while aromatic herbs like sage and rosemary can enhance flavor and repel invaders.

Avoid planting beets next to Swiss chard or pole beans, which may compete as well as attract similar pests. And don’t forget crop rotation—move your beets around the garden each year to keep the soil balanced and disease-free.

Harvesting, Storing, and Enjoying Your Beets

Beets offer flexibility in the kitchen and garden alike. Harvest them young for tender baby beets, or let them mature for a deeper flavor.

Always store them in a cool, humid place like a root cellar or fridge drawer, and be sure to save the greens—these nutrient-packed leaves can be sautéed, added to soups, or used raw in salads.

Beets also store well through the winter, giving you a long-lasting source of nutrition long after the growing season ends.

From Juice to Kvass: Beets in the Kitchen

Beets are culinary chameleons. Juice them with carrots and citrus for a detoxifying drink. Roast them for a caramelized, savory side dish.

Ferment them into beet kvass to add probiotics and deepen their detox effects. Or pickle them for a sweet and tangy treat that pairs beautifully with meats, salads, and cheeses. However you prepare them, beets lend bold flavor, vibrant color, and a serious nutritional punch to any meal.
